Dishwasher Salary in Lakewood, CO
Dishwashers in Lakewood, CO, earn approximately $17.41 per hour, which translates to about $696.40 per week, $3,017.73 per month, and $36,212.80 per year.
The demand for Dishwashers in Lakewood is growing steadily at about 5% per year, indicating a healthy and expanding job market for this essential role in the hospitality and food service industries.
How Much Does a Dishwasher Make in Lakewood, CO?
The salary of a Dishwasher in Lakewood, CO can vary depending on experience and the specific employer, but here is a general breakdown of earnings at various experience levels.
| Experience level | Hourly pay | Weekly pay | Monthly pay | Yearly pay |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Entry-level (~25th percentile) | $15.32 | $612.80 | $2,648.53 | $31,782.40 |
| Mid-level (average) | $17.41 | $696.40 | $3,017.73 | $36,212.80 |
| Top earners (90th percentile) | $19.78 | $791.20 | $3,414.13 | $40,102.40 |
Do Dishwashers in Lakewood, CO Earn Tips?
Dishwashers generally do not earn tips as their work primarily involves back-of-house duties without direct customer interaction. Their earnings are typically based on their hourly wage alone.
Dishwasher Salary in Lakewood, CO vs. National Average
Nationally, Dishwashers earn an average of around $15.32 per hour, which equates to about $31,865.60 per year.
Compared to the national average, Lakewood Dishwashers earn slightly more, with an average hourly wage of $17.41 and an annual salary of $36,212.80.
This higher salary can be attributed to the regional cost of living in Colorado and the local demand for kitchen staff in hospitality sectors.
Highest-Paying Areas Near Lakewood, CO for Dishwashers
Nearby areas with higher Dishwasher salaries include:
- Lone Tree: $20.80 per hour
- Denver: $19.73 per hour
Those willing to commute to Lone Tree or Denver can expect better earning potential compared to Lakewood.
What Influences a Dishwasher’s Salary in Lakewood, CO?
Several factors influence how much a Dishwasher can earn in Lakewood, CO, including:
- Experience: More experienced Dishwashers can negotiate higher wages or qualify for promotions.
- Skills and Efficiency: Speed, reliability, and the ability to manage multiple tasks can impact salary and advancement opportunities.
- Type of Establishment: Dishwashers in upscale restaurants and hotels tend to earn more than those in casual or fast-food settings.
- Shift Hours: Working night shifts, weekends, or holidays may lead to additional pay through shift differentials.
How To Become a Dishwasher in Lakewood, CO
Starting a career as a Dishwasher typically requires minimal formal education, but taking certain steps can enhance job prospects and earnings.
- Obtain Basic Food Safety Certification: Certifications such as the ServSafe Food Handler Certification demonstrate an understanding of food safety practices and are often required by employers.
- Gain Practical Experience: Entry-level positions or internships within restaurants and catering can provide hands-on experience.
- Consider Culinary Arts Training: Attending institutions such as the Auguste Escoffier School of Culinary Arts in Boulder or Colorado Mountain College can provide foundational knowledge about kitchen operations and food service.
- Pursue Additional Certifications: The American Culinary Federation (ACF) Certification offers various credentials for food service professionals that can open opportunities for advancement.

Establishments That Dishwashers in Lakewood, CO Work At
Dishwashers in Lakewood find employment in a variety of venues, each affecting their salary potential differently.
- Casual and Fast Casual Restaurants: Often employ Dishwashers with competitive but moderate pay due to higher turnover.
- Hotels and Resorts: Typically offer higher wages and benefits, reflecting the scale and prestige of the establishment.
- Fine Dining Establishments: May pay more for Dishwashers who maintain high standards and work efficiently during busy service hours.
- Institutional Kitchens (e.g., Hospitals, Schools): Provide consistent work with standard wages but generally less opportunity for tips or bonuses.
